A arquitetura de segurança da Taiko integra várias funcionalidades avançadas para garantir a segurança, eficácia e descentralização do protocolo, mantendo a compatibilidade com o Ethereum. Essas medidas de segurança foram especialmente projetadas para proteger a integridade da rede, garantir transações seguras aos usuários e permitir a expansão efetiva do sistema sem sacrificar seus princípios básicos de segurança.
Anteriormente mencionamos os ZK-Rollups. Em termos de segurança, eles também são um componente poderoso, permitindo que os dados de transação sejam processados off-chain, ao mesmo tempo que apenas submetem as provas criptográficas (ZK-SNARKs) à rede principal da Ethereum.
ZK-Rollups utiliza provas de conhecimento zero sucintas e não interativas (ZK-SNARKs, Zero-Knowledge Succinct Non-Interactive Arguments of Knowledge) para validar transações sem revelar nenhum detalhe sobre elas, o que ajuda a garantir que a validade dessas transações possa ser confirmada na cadeia, mesmo que os dados de transação sejam processados fora da cadeia. As provas ZK-SNARKs garantem que os cálculos foram executados corretamente sem expor os dados reais, mantendo assim a privacidade e a segurança.
Ao reduzir a carga de dados na cadeia, garante-se que seja possível reconstruir o estado completo do Rollup a partir dessas provas. Isso garante que a cadeia Layer 2 esteja sempre consistente com a rede principal do Ethereum e evita a adulteração de dados fora da cadeia.
A arquitetura da Taiko é projetada para ajustar dinamicamente o nível de segurança de acordo com as necessidades da rede. Inicialmente, pode-se usar provas mais econômicas, mas à medida que a rede cresce e a necessidade de segurança mais avançada surge, pode-se fazer a transição para provas ZK mais seguras. Esse tipo de adaptabilidade garante que a Taiko possa expandir suas medidas de segurança de acordo com as necessidades em constante mudança da rede.
A arquitetura BCR no Taiko introduz um sistema de múltiplas provas que pode gerar e disputar vários tipos de provas. A arquitetura BCR assegura que, se houver suspeitas de invalidade de um bloco, pode ser desafiado. Cada camada de prova no sistema está associada a títulos de validade que o provador deve publicar. Se a prova for desafiada com sucesso, o provador original perderá o seu título, que será concedido ao desafiante. Este mecanismo aumenta a segurança no nível econômico, pois impede a submissão de provas fraudulentas ao torná-las economicamente arriscadas.
O sistema de prova de permissão e descentralização do Taiko é uma funcionalidade de segurança importante, pois permite que qualquer participante com recursos computacionais suficientes se torne um provador, dispersando assim o processo e reduzindo o risco de centralização. Vários provadores geram provas em paralelo, e o primeiro a submeter uma prova válida é recompensado. Esse ambiente competitivo garante a segurança da rede e apenas aceita provas precisas.
Os guardiões do Provedor de Provas desempenham um papel adicional de segurança nas primeiras fases de implantação da rede. Eles são signatários de múltiplas assinaturas responsáveis por supervisionar as provas de mais alto nível e garantir a integridade do sistema durante a fase inicial de implantação. O papel dos guardiões do Provedor de Provas é temporário e visa ser gradualmente eliminado à medida que o sistema amadurece e se torna mais estável.
Este método de fase permite que a Taiko equilibre segurança e descentralização enquanto a rede ainda está em estágios iniciais. Com o tempo, à medida que o sistema ZK-Rollup se torna mais testado e confiável, a demanda por guardiões provadores diminui, avançando em direção a um modelo de segurança completamente descentralizado e auto-sustentável. Quando um bloco é proposto, ele entra em um período de resfriamento, durante o qual qualquer participante pode questionar a validade das provas fornecidas pelos provadores.
Ao combinar esses recursos, a arquitetura do Taiko fornece uma plataforma segura, escalável e descentralizada para construir e operar aplicativos compatíveis com o Ethereum. A combinação de ZK-Rollups, arquitetura BCR, sistema de prova descentralizada e a introdução gradual de guardiões garante que o Taiko possa manter altos padrões de segurança, ao mesmo tempo em que oferece a flexibilidade necessária para atender às demandas em constante mudança da rede.
Destaque
A arquitetura de segurança da Taiko integra várias funcionalidades avançadas para garantir a segurança, eficácia e descentralização do protocolo, mantendo a compatibilidade com o Ethereum. Essas medidas de segurança foram especialmente projetadas para proteger a integridade da rede, garantir transações seguras aos usuários e permitir a expansão efetiva do sistema sem sacrificar seus princípios básicos de segurança.
Anteriormente mencionamos os ZK-Rollups. Em termos de segurança, eles também são um componente poderoso, permitindo que os dados de transação sejam processados off-chain, ao mesmo tempo que apenas submetem as provas criptográficas (ZK-SNARKs) à rede principal da Ethereum.
ZK-Rollups utiliza provas de conhecimento zero sucintas e não interativas (ZK-SNARKs, Zero-Knowledge Succinct Non-Interactive Arguments of Knowledge) para validar transações sem revelar nenhum detalhe sobre elas, o que ajuda a garantir que a validade dessas transações possa ser confirmada na cadeia, mesmo que os dados de transação sejam processados fora da cadeia. As provas ZK-SNARKs garantem que os cálculos foram executados corretamente sem expor os dados reais, mantendo assim a privacidade e a segurança.
Ao reduzir a carga de dados na cadeia, garante-se que seja possível reconstruir o estado completo do Rollup a partir dessas provas. Isso garante que a cadeia Layer 2 esteja sempre consistente com a rede principal do Ethereum e evita a adulteração de dados fora da cadeia.
A arquitetura da Taiko é projetada para ajustar dinamicamente o nível de segurança de acordo com as necessidades da rede. Inicialmente, pode-se usar provas mais econômicas, mas à medida que a rede cresce e a necessidade de segurança mais avançada surge, pode-se fazer a transição para provas ZK mais seguras. Esse tipo de adaptabilidade garante que a Taiko possa expandir suas medidas de segurança de acordo com as necessidades em constante mudança da rede.
A arquitetura BCR no Taiko introduz um sistema de múltiplas provas que pode gerar e disputar vários tipos de provas. A arquitetura BCR assegura que, se houver suspeitas de invalidade de um bloco, pode ser desafiado. Cada camada de prova no sistema está associada a títulos de validade que o provador deve publicar. Se a prova for desafiada com sucesso, o provador original perderá o seu título, que será concedido ao desafiante. Este mecanismo aumenta a segurança no nível econômico, pois impede a submissão de provas fraudulentas ao torná-las economicamente arriscadas.
O sistema de prova de permissão e descentralização do Taiko é uma funcionalidade de segurança importante, pois permite que qualquer participante com recursos computacionais suficientes se torne um provador, dispersando assim o processo e reduzindo o risco de centralização. Vários provadores geram provas em paralelo, e o primeiro a submeter uma prova válida é recompensado. Esse ambiente competitivo garante a segurança da rede e apenas aceita provas precisas.
Os guardiões do Provedor de Provas desempenham um papel adicional de segurança nas primeiras fases de implantação da rede. Eles são signatários de múltiplas assinaturas responsáveis por supervisionar as provas de mais alto nível e garantir a integridade do sistema durante a fase inicial de implantação. O papel dos guardiões do Provedor de Provas é temporário e visa ser gradualmente eliminado à medida que o sistema amadurece e se torna mais estável.
Este método de fase permite que a Taiko equilibre segurança e descentralização enquanto a rede ainda está em estágios iniciais. Com o tempo, à medida que o sistema ZK-Rollup se torna mais testado e confiável, a demanda por guardiões provadores diminui, avançando em direção a um modelo de segurança completamente descentralizado e auto-sustentável. Quando um bloco é proposto, ele entra em um período de resfriamento, durante o qual qualquer participante pode questionar a validade das provas fornecidas pelos provadores.
Ao combinar esses recursos, a arquitetura do Taiko fornece uma plataforma segura, escalável e descentralizada para construir e operar aplicativos compatíveis com o Ethereum. A combinação de ZK-Rollups, arquitetura BCR, sistema de prova descentralizada e a introdução gradual de guardiões garante que o Taiko possa manter altos padrões de segurança, ao mesmo tempo em que oferece a flexibilidade necessária para atender às demandas em constante mudança da rede.
Destaque